OK folks, I require your expert knowledge of mixing. How strong is the FA White Peach flavor? I am going to make another batch of WF Peach Gummy Candy, and thought about adding the White Peach to it at about 1%. I do not want it to overpower the Peach Gummy, which will probably be around 3.5%. I just kind of want it as a background note. But having never used white peach, I was unsure how overpowering the flavor would be. As always, your help and advice is appreciated.

    @hittman How’s your opinion of the Alpine going? Do you really think it’s a better strawberry than the ones we normally use?

    It’s hard to say since I’m just trying it with Flv cream and think two drops was too strong for 10ml. I’m not sure how long to let it steep after mixing it with the cheesecake this morning. I’ve struggled finding the right combination of strawberries and figured if I liked the alpine enough then I could forget about combining. For sure it takes a lot less than any other strawberry flavor I’ve tried. I mixed some cheesecake with succulent strawberry and it took 6% to be close to as strong as the alpine is with two drops.

    "The Umbrella Academy" . . . Is a slightly different type of series similar to "Stranger Things", but much better . . . It is base upon a comic book about a group of different Children from around the world adopted by a quirky Scientist (English Type who carries an umbrella) that brings them all together to live and study in "The Umbrella Academy" . . . It starts when all the children - years after they all went their separate ways & living very different lives - return home after their "Father" has died . . . Each child is very "Special" and they have some extraordinary talents and abilities . . . There is a huge "Family" secret that they eventually uncovered, especially when they regress to past memories and even the "future" . . . Very Interesting and Captivating Series . . . A must watch for those who are into Science Fiction and/or something "Quirky" (Think "DeadPool") . . . :thumbs: :thumbs::thumbs::thumbs::thumbs:
